Celebrated annually on the occasion of National Youth Day, Kshitij is a heartwarming flagship initiative of United Way of Baroda that promotes inclusion, friendship, and social harmony by bringing together specially-abled children, youth volunteers, corporates, educational institutions, and community members. The event serves as a platform to sensitise young people towards the importance of disability inclusion while creating opportunities for meaningful interaction and shared experiences. Participants enjoy a day filled with kite flying, cultural performances, music, dance, games, and traditional Gujarati delicacies, fostering an atmosphere of joy, laughter, and togetherness. Beyond the festivities, Kshitij encourages empathy, mutual respect, and the breaking down of social barriers by demonstrating that inclusion is achieved through participation and understanding. Living up to its name, which means “horizon,” the event inspires everyone with the belief that “The sky is not the limit—it’s where dreams take flight,” reflecting United Way of Baroda’s vision of empowering every individual to reach their fullest potential regardless of their abilities.

The Government of India declared to observe the birth anniversary of Swami Vivekananda -12thJanuary- as National Youth Day in 1984. KSHITIJ is a social initiative by United Way Of Baroda for the differently abled children and the youth of Baroda to come together and celebrate Uttarayan & National Youth Day. “KSHITIJ” was organized on 12th January, 2017 at Prof. Manikrao’s Shree Jummadada Vyayam Mandir, Vadodara, wherein 500 special children and youth participated. They enjoyed Kite flying along with music and dance. Traditional food such as Undhiyu, Jalebi, and Chikki was served. It was a soul satisfying experience to bring smile on the faces these children with support of the youth.
